You probably have many questions about eligibility for Medicare coverage in NJ, like many local residents. Medicare has many parts. If you’re 65 or older and if you or a spouse has paid taxes into Medicare for a minimum of 10 years you are eligible for Medicare free of premiums. There are other circumstances where someone could find themselves eligible for Medicare earlier than this, including having a disability or permanent kidney failure involving the requirements for transplant or dialysis. Under certain conditions you may additionally be capable of buying into Medicare part A if you’re 65 or over but have not paid Medicare taxes while working. Special Medicare Enrollment Warren County NJ
If you’re looking for a local Medicare advantage advisor in New Jersey serving New Jersey, the Medicare Group is here. Even if you have Medicare currently, you’re not capable of making any plan changes unless you experience something referred to as a Qualifying Life Event.
Examples of a Qualifying Life Event include:
- Losing your present coverage
- Moving to a new location
- Your plan’s Medicare contract changes
Adjusting your present plan is capable of occurring once one of these or other Qualifying Life Events occur. This might include switching to Medicare Advantage Plan or adding Medicare Supplement Insurance. Do I Need Medicare Secondary Insurance in In New Jersey?
When you’d like the highest possible degree of coverage while keeping your out-of-pocket costs to a minimum, it’s important to look into a plan for Medigap in NJ. A significant amount of coverage is offered by Medicare. However, medical expenses can be fairly high, which means even your remaining out-of-pocket costs can be rather high. When you’re on a budget this is especially important consider. This gaps are capable of being filled in by a Medigap plan, ensuring you get the greatest amount of coverage. Medigap works side by side with Original Medicare, meaning it’s different from a Medicare Advantage Plan. The federal government makes certain that the benefits these plans offer are standardized.
